Hello, Clacton-on-Sea! We’re bringing our full fibre broadband to your town.

We’re building our 1 gigabit full fibre broadband in Clacton-on-Sea (including Holland-on-Sea) and residents will be able to connect later this Spring.

We marked the ‘light speed’ roll-out of our network by meeting Deputy Cabinet Member and Essex County Councillor Mark Platt, and Tendring District Councillor Mick Skeels, at one of our build locations in Clacton-on-Sea recently. Our team were delighted to demonstrate how we’re rolling out our broadband network sustainably and efficiently across the town and the region.

Councillor Mark Platt, said: “It was a pleasure […] to hear about the progress of the company’s full fibre broadband roll-out to multiple towns across Essex helping to level up our region. This is a fantastic opportunity for the local area, and I am delighted that residents and businesses will be able to benefit from LightSpeed’s full fibre connectivity later this year.”

Councillor Mick Skeels, added: “It was good to see LightSpeed’s full fibre broadband build in Clacton recently as it progresses across the town. The company’s investment supports the economic development of Clacton and is an important step in bringing new opportunities to the area.”
